Key match information
Oriente Petrolero played San Antonio Bulo Bulo in LFPB (Bolivia). The match was played on 22 August 2026. Venue: Estadio Ramón Aguilera Costas. Final score: 4:0.

General match analysis
Oriente Petrolero are extremely strong at home, winning 71% of their matches, scoring an average of 2.14 goals and conceding just 0.71, while San Antonio Bulo Bulo have failed to win a single away game. The visitors have lost 86% of their away fixtures, conceding an average of 2.71 goals, with their away goal difference standing at -14. The hosts also create significantly better chances, averaging 1.58 xG with 0.99 xG against, whereas their opponents allow chances worth an average of 2.22 xG. In their last five matches, Oriente won 4 times and scored 12 goals, while San Antonio managed just 6 goals during the same period. Additionally, the visitors have failed to score in 43% of their away matches, which, combined with Oriente’s 43% clean-sheet rate at home, further supports the scenario of a comfortable home win.
